Two students of a private college died when the two-wheeler they were travelling on rammed a tree on the side of Coimbatore – Palakkad Road at Madukkarai in Coimbatore district on Thursday noon.

The deceased have been identified as Sylesh Vishwanathan, 20, of Sengottai in Tenkasi district and Surya Narayanan, 20, of Kurichi housing unit in Coimbatore. They had been doing third year of undergraduation in a private college at Kuniyamuthur.

The police said the accident took place at 12.10 p.m. near the military camp at Madukkarai. Vishwanathan, who had been residing at P.K. Pudur, rode the two-wheeler with Narayanan on the pillion in a rash and negligent manner. He lost control of the two-wheeler and it rammed a tree on the side of the road, killing both of them on the spot, the police said.
